Deck Waterproofing in Puyallup, WA
Deck waterproofing services involve applying protective coatings or membranes to outdoor decks to prevent water infiltration and damage. This service is suitable for various types of projects, including wooden, composite, or concrete decks, especially those exposed to frequent rain or moisture. Property owners typically seek this service to extend the lifespan of their decks, prevent wood rot, and maintain a safe, attractive outdoor space. Before requesting deck waterproofing, it’s important to understand the current condition of the deck, including any existing damage or deterioration, as well as the type of surface material to ensure the appropriate waterproofing method is used.
Homeowners often want to know about the different waterproofing options available, such as sealants, membranes, or coatings, and how each may impact the deck’s appearance and durability. Clarifying the scope of the project, including surface preparation and potential repairs, helps set realistic expectations. Additionally, understanding the maintenance requirements after waterproofing can assist property owners in keeping their decks protected over time. Properly waterproofed decks can provide a longer-lasting, more resilient outdoor area, especially in regions prone to wet weather.

Deck Waterproofing Questions
What is deck waterproofing? Deck waterproofing involves applying a protective layer to prevent water from penetrating the surface, helping to extend the lifespan of the deck.
What types of decks benefit from waterproofing? Wooden, concrete, and composite decks all benefit from waterproofing to resist moisture damage and reduce slipping.
How does waterproofing improve deck durability? It shields the surface from water exposure, preventing rot, mold, and structural deterioration over time.
When should a deck be waterproofed? Waterproofing is recommended during initial construction or when signs of water damage or wear begin to appear.
